8 Nineveh is a reservoir whose water is draining away. |Wait! Wait!| they cry, yet not even one person looks back. 9 Take the silver! Take the gold! There is no end to the treasure— fabulous riches of every imagination. 10 Nineveh is devastated, deserted, and desolate. Her heart melts, her knees knock. Every stomach is upset, every face grows pale. 11 Where is this lion's den? Where is the place where the young lions fed, where the lion and its mate walked with their young, the place where they feared nothing? 12 This lion renders its prey to pieces to feed its whelps, and strangles enough prey for its mate, filling its lairs with prey and its dens with rendered flesh. 13 |I am against you,| declares the LORD of the Heavenly Armies, |and I will send your chariots up in smoke. A sword will devour your young lions, I will eliminate your prey from the earth, and the voice of your messengers will no longer be heard.| Nahum 2:8-13, Intl. Standard Version.
